The annual Academic Ranking of World Universities has been released and UBC has landed second in the country and 37th in the world.
Taking top spot for a Canadian university was the University of Toronto, followed by UBC and McGill. Worldwide Toronto landed 24th on the list and McGill 67th. At the bottom of the list in very last spot was York University, which has landed in bottom spot for the last five years. Topping the list for 2014 was ivy league school Harvard University, followed by Stanford and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T).
UBC inched up slightly from 2013 where it placed 40th on the list. American universities continue to dominate the rankings, which is compiled of several different factors including; quality of education, quality of faculty, research output and per capita performance.
The Academic Ranking of World Universities (ARWU) is conducted by researchers at the Center for World-Class Universities of Shanghai Jiao Tong University (CWCU).
